The event this weekend drew 107 entries, had 30 cashers, a 1 in 3.5 cash ratio and paid out nearly $5,000.00 in main and side event prizefunds. The players bowled on the newest version of the Scorpion pattern which was at 47ft long. It was pretty clear there wasn't going to be many players hooking it a whole lot. The pattern however, did allow players to play further right as long as they had slower ball speeds. It was very clear however, that players that could play a tighter angle in the middle of the lane had the best ball reaction. Although the pattern was longer, and had less "hook", the scores were fairly high all weekend with the average cut score being slightly above +100.

The semi-final matches were between #1 seed Ron Schloss and #2 seed Ken Love in the A Division, #1 seed Jonathan Ferrell and #2 seed Billy Pretlove in the B Division, and #1 seed Tom Large and #2 seed Ted McKay in the C Division. The A division match wasn't very close with Ron continuing his dominance with a huge 250+ game and the front 7 strikes. The B division final match was fairly close until the end which Jonthan Ferrell threw some strikes when he needed them to defeat Billy. The C division was the closest of the three with Tom Large having the ability to strike out in the 10th to win by 1 pin. Tom threw the first, but left a four pin on the second shot for Ted McKay to move on.

Ted was the only person in the finals that had been in a final match and also had a title. The match started off with all of the players in the pocket, but early on Ted and Ron started off with strikes. Ted and Ron both had front 3 with a spare in the 4th. This was great to watch, but tough for Ron since he was spotting Ted 30 pins for the match. Ted and Ron ended up having about the same scoring pace for the rest of the game. Ron was unable to make up the handicap difference, with Ted bowling his highest scratch score of the weekend when he needed it the most! Congrats to Ted on his 2nd SFT AHT title and to the other finalists on making their first ever title match!
